Match Notes


EVANSTON, Ill. – Another busy weekend awaits the Northwestern volleyball team at the Lipscomb Invitational in Nashville, Tenn. The Wildcats (4-2) will square off against Virginia Tech and Lipscomb in a Friday doubleheader before wrapping up competition against Ole Miss on Saturday.
 
Chicago's Big Ten Team faces Virginia Tech at 10 a.m. CT Friday morning and host school Lipscomb at 7:30 p.m. The 'Cats take on the Rebels at 12:30 p.m. Saturday afternoon.
 
The Wildcats hold the edge in all three limited all-time series.

SYMONE SLAM
Junior outside hitter Symone Abbott has begun the season on a tear. She is averaging 4.8 kills per set through the first six matches, which ranks first in the Big Ten and 13th nationally. She had 22 kills in a three-set match vs. George Washington to open the season, which is the fourth-most in the NCAA this year and second-most in program history for a three-setter. Abbott is hitting .365 for the season, and her .700 mark against Buffalo (14-for-20) is the fourth-best performance in the country for a three-set match.
 
HAMMER IT HOME
Northwestern's dominant start to the season has put it near the top of the national charts in hitting. The Wildcats rank third in the Big Ten and eighth in the country with a .310 team hitting percentage. Chicago's Big Ten Team ranks 7th in the Big Ten with 13.6 kills per set.
 
MILESTONE TRACKER
Taylor Tashima's moved into ninth-place all-time at Northwestern in assists with her 37th and final against Chattanoota. She currently sits at 2,260 for her career and is just 75 away from eighth. At her current pace she could end up as high as fourth by the end of the season.
 
WHERE THEY RANK
Northwestern ranks third in the Big Ten in hitting percentage (.310) and seventh in kills (13.6) and aces (1.4). Individually, Symone Abbott leads the conference with 4.8 kills per set. Abbott also ranks eighth with 0.8 aces per set, and Taylor Tashima ranks sixth with 10.7 assists per set. New liberto Katie Kniep is ninth with 3.9 digs per set.
